<td>On August 30, 2009 closes <em>&#8216;Fiddler on the Roof&#8217;: The Farewell Tour</em>. It will take place in Portland, Oregon. It has only left for classics lovers to wait for another chance to see the favorite musical, songs and actors.<br />
The most popular Broadway musical of all times and nations opened on September 22, 1964 at the Imperial Theatre. Its popularity was shocking. The next day after the opening night it became clear that the musical would come into history. The best testimony to it is 3242 performances for 8 years and 9 months and 9 Tony Awards received in 1965.</td>

<td>Initially, <strong>Fiddler on The Roof</strong> was entitled Tevye. The reason is the story is based on Tevye and his Dauhters (or Tevye the Milkman) tale.<br />
Fiddler on the Roof was screened as early as 1971 by Norman Jewison. It turned out to be a real success. The film came into top 10 best films-musicals along with “Mary Poppins”, “My Fair Lady” and “West Side Story”. The film received 3 <strong>Oscars</strong>: the best screen version, the best sound and music; it received a <strong>Golden Globe</strong> as the best film (comedy or musical) as well.</td>

<td>The film is serious and philosophical, despite an abundance of cheerful moments which help to restrain tears.<br />
There are lots of interesting facts connected with the world-known musical. For example, on May 26, 2008 <em>TIME magazine</em> reported that the <strong>Fiddler on the Roof</strong> became the 7th most frequently performed musical by U.S. high schools.</td>
